In a recent report published by MarkWide Research, titled “Household Finances Market,” the global household finances market is on track for steady growth in the coming years. With an anticipated comp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.8% from 2023 to 2030, the market is set to experience substantial expansion.
Increasing Focus on Financial Wellness Drives Market Growth
The household finances market is witnessing consistent growth driven by the growing emphasis on financial wellness, budgeting, and planning among households worldwide. In an era marked by economic uncertainties, individuals and families are increasingly seeking tools and services to manage their finances effectively.
Key Market Drivers
- Financial Literacy Initiatives: Government and private sector efforts to improve financial literacy encourage responsible financial management.
- Digital Financial Solutions: The proliferation of fintech solutions enhances accessibility and convenience for consumers.
- Retirement Planning: The aging global population underscores the importance of retirement savings and investment.
- Debt Management: Rising consumer debt levels drive demand for debt consolidation and management services.
Market Segment Analysis
The household finances market can be segmented based on product and service type, platform, end-user, and region.
By Product and Service Type:
- Savings and Investment Products: Including savings accounts, mutual funds, and investment advisory services.
- Budgeting and Financial Planning Tools: Software and apps for budgeting, expense tracking, and financial goal setting.
- Debt Management Services: Debt consolidation, credit counseling, and debt settlement.
- Insurance Products: Life insurance, health insurance, and property insurance.
- Retirement Planning Services: Services and tools for retirement savings and planning.
By Platform:
- Online and Mobile: Digital platforms and apps for financial management.
- Brick-and-Mortar: Traditional banks and financial institutions.
By End-User:
- Individuals and Households: Personal financial management tools and services.
- Financial Institutions: Offering financial products and services to consumers.
- Government and Non-Profit Organizations: Promoting financial literacy and education.
By Region:
- North America: A mature market with a strong focus on financial education.
- Europe: Increasing adoption of digital financial tools and services.
- Asia-Pacific: Emerging as a significant player in the household finances market.

Competitive Landscape
Key players in the household finances market include:
- Intuit Inc. (Makers of Quicken and TurboTax): A leading provider of financial software solutions.
- The Vanguard Group, Inc.: Known for its investment products and retirement planning services.
- Fidelity Investments: Offers a wide range of financial products and services.
- Mint (by Intuit): A popular personal finance app for budgeting and expense tracking.
- Experian plc: Provides credit monitoring and financial management tools.
